The High Stakes of Water in Critical Infrastructure
Let us be specific about what water downtime actually means in these environments, because the stakes are very different from a regular commercial building.
In a hospital, water is directly tied to patient safety. Operating theatres require a continuous, clean water supply for sterilisation between procedures. ICUs depend on it for wound care and infection control. Dialysis units cannot function without it — a single session requires anywhere between 120 and 150 litres of highly purified water per patient. The kitchen, laundry, and sanitation systems are all running simultaneously, all day, every day.
A disruption to any one of these water points does not just create an operational problem. It creates a compliance problem, a hygiene risk, and in some cases, a direct threat to patient outcomes.
Hotels face a different but equally serious pressure. A guest who checks in after a long journey and finds no hot water in their room does not quietly accept it. They post about it. In the age of Google Reviews and TripAdvisor ratings, a single bad experience — one that could have been prevented with proper monitoring — can cost a property far more than the cost of fixing the problem itself.
For large hotels with multiple floors, banquet halls, spas, and commercial kitchens running simultaneously, the water infrastructure is complex. And complexity without oversight is where failures hide.
The Problem With Fixing Things After They Break
Most facilities, even well-managed ones, are still running on a reactive model when it comes to water management.
The tank runs low — someone notices. The pump stops working — maintenance gets called. Water quality drops — complaints start coming in, and then an investigation begins.
This approach might be acceptable in a low-stakes environment. But in a hospital or a hotel, by the time you are reacting, the damage is already done.
Consider a small but common scenario: a slow leak develops in a pipe connecting an overhead tank to the third-floor supply line. The leak is not dramatic — just a steady drip that does not trigger any visible alarm. Over three days, the tank drains faster than usual. On the morning of day four, the third floor has no water supply. A hotel floor full of guests. A hospital ward mid-shift.
No alarm was triggered because there was no system monitoring the consumption rate. Nobody noticed because the tank looked fine from the outside. The leak was small enough that the daily manual check did not catch it.
This is not a failure of the maintenance team. This is a failure of the infrastructure they were given to work with.
Reactive management works until it does not. In critical facilities, the cost of that failure is simply too high to accept.
IoT Monitoring: 24/7 Oversight Without the Manpower
The shift from reactive to proactive water management comes down to one thing: real-time visibility.
When every water tank in your facility is connected to an IoT monitoring system, the data that used to require a manual check — tank level, fill rate, consumption trend — becomes available continuously, without anyone having to physically inspect anything.
More importantly, the system does not just show you what is happening. It tells you what is about to happen.
If a tank that normally holds a 12-hour supply is draining in 8 hours, an alert goes out. If a tank is filling but not reaching its expected level — suggesting a possible overflow or leak somewhere in the line — the system flags it. If consumption spikes abnormally at 3 AM when the facility should be at its quietest, someone gets notified.

Compliance, Audits, and the Paper Trail You Actually Need
There is another dimension to water management in critical facilities that often gets overlooked until it becomes urgent: documentation.
Hospitals and healthcare facilities operate under strict regulatory frameworks. Water quality, supply continuity, and tank hygiene are all areas that come under scrutiny during inspections and audits. Producing accurate, timestamped records of tank levels, pump operations, and maintenance interventions is not optional — it is a requirement.
Hotels certified under international quality standards or operating under franchise agreements often face similar documentation expectations. Proving that water supply was maintained within specified parameters, that tanks were cleaned at the right intervals, and that anomalies were addressed promptly requires records that a manual logbook simply cannot provide reliably.
An IoT monitoring system solves this automatically. Every reading, every alert, and every threshold breach is logged with a timestamp and stored in the system. When an audit happens, you are not scrambling to compile records. You pull the report, filter by date range, and hand it over.
It is a small thing until the day of an inspection. Then it matters enormously.
